Growing and Sustaining OSS: Evolution of the Ceph Development Process
Ceph is a fully open source distributed storage system that started in a university lab, and has now reached 100K commits from nearly 800 contributors from all over the world. The use cases for Ceph a …
Talk Title | Growing and Sustaining OSS: Evolution of the Ceph Development Process |
Speakers | Neha Ojha (Senior Software Engineer, Red Hat) |
Conference | Open Source Summit + ELC Europe |
Conf Tag | |
Location | Lyon, France |
Date | Oct 27-Nov 1, 2019 |
URL | Talk Page |
Slides | Talk Slides |
Video | |
Ceph is a fully open source distributed storage system that started in a university lab, and has now reached 100K commits from nearly 800 contributors from all over the world. The use cases for Ceph are broad; from providing shared file systems in small private clusters, Ceph scales to meet the needs of even modern public clouds. Like other large OSS projects, a diverse set of tools and procedures have grown up around the user and development community.This talk will explore the unique aspects of the size and scope of Ceph development process, and how the community is trying to improve the overall experience through documentation. The nature of many large software projects means documentation and reality are often drifting further apart, and this is especially true for projects like Ceph that are constantly evolving to meet the needs of new hardware systems and operating environments.